Machu Picchu train line reopens after protesters strike deal to readmit tourists

3 months ago 29

Access to Incan site in Peruvian Andes restored after dispute over new electronic rail ticketing system

Peruvian authorities have reopened the train route to Machu Picchu, after an agreement was struck to end more than a week of protests that had blocked access to the famed Incan site and stranded tourists.

PeruRail said in a statement a partial service had restarted on Wednesday and that a regular service would return on Thursday from the city of Cusco to Aguas Calientes, a town near the archaeological site.
